Output 6c926edec7007bd1de2e3fa579077cac93f6827e1eefa6a19a19ae3a12315f86:26

value
11523931
script pubkey
OP_0 OP_PUSHBYTES_20 18a66c16a83d8b8035e2f929a561d16e6a66f11c
address
bc1qrznxc94g8k9cqd0zly562cw3de4xdugu5r8wg5
transaction
6c926edec7007bd1de2e3fa579077cac93f6827e1eefa6a19a19ae3a12315f86
spent
true